The bite was a little slow,,but we did end up with a big one!

This fish hit a live menhaden on the bottom while fishing in about 40' of water with 30lb tackle.
After I vented the air bladder on the fish, he was released in great shape.

Jeff,,,You asked,
Do you use a slip sinker and a circle hook? Like a Carolina rig? Yes, I do



What size circle hook? How much leader? I use short shank 6/0 live bait hooks with 3' of 50 or 80lb mono leader.
